    Think about how your driving influences your insurance premiums, driving safely often leads to reduced costs. Nowadays, insurance companies are checking things like your driving habits and mileage with tech gadgets to adjust what you pay. Bundling different insurance policies together can make things easier, but it might not always be the smartest choice financially. If you’re in a higher-risk situation, sometimes having separate policies can actually save you more money. It’s a good idea to compare what you’d pay in both cases so you don’t end up spending more just for the sake of convenience.

  • Car insurance coverage types explained?

    2
    0 Votes
    2 Posts
    83 Views
    K

    Liability insurance comes into the picture when you are responsible for others' damage.
    Collision covers damage done to your car from an accident.
    Comprehensive protects against non-collision incidents like theft or damage done because of weather.
    All these coverages offer distinct forms of protection for different types of events.

  • Car insurance expired today.

    2
    0 Votes
    2 Posts
    53 Views
    M

    Hi

    If you can’t pay the car insurance today, then ask about the grace period for late payments. Some companies allow grace periods for late payments. This facility varies among the insurance companies.

    If you have time to pay for the insurance, pay immediately. There can be a late fee, but there shouldn’t be a coverage delay if you renew.

    If the grace period is gone, then your policy might be cancelled, and you need to buy a new policy. Contact your insurance company as soon as possible.
